A relaxed interface supports rational thinking

A relaxed interface is more than just an aesthetic choice; it is a fundamental factor in shaping the way users engage with digital environments. When the visual, interactive, and informational elements are designed with calmness in mind, users experience a sense of control that directly impacts their decision-making. Subtle colors, clear typography, and uncluttered layouts reduce mental strain, allowing the brain to focus on meaningful tasks rather than processing distractions. In a fast-paced digital world, where notifications, alerts, and visual noise compete for attention, the absence of stress-inducing elements becomes a stabilizing force that encourages thoughtful interaction.

Cognitive science suggests that environments which minimize overstimulation contribute to better executive function. Executive functions—like planning, risk assessment, and working memory—thrive in spaces that do not demand constant vigilance. A relaxed interface, with predictable and intuitive patterns, allows users to anticipate outcomes, creating a mental space where strategic thinking can flourish. When feedback is smooth and consistent, users are less likely to react impulsively, leading to decisions that are deliberate and rational. The psychology of design thus intersects with behavioral outcomes, showing that calm interfaces are not merely pleasant but actively support reasoning.

Consistency in design is another cornerstone of relaxed interfaces. When users encounter uniform visual cues and familiar navigational elements, they expend less cognitive energy figuring out how to act. This predictability reduces anxiety, especially in complex systems where users must make multiple decisions in sequence. For example, in financial platforms or gaming environments, consistent feedback about actions, outcomes, and probabilities allows users to process information with clarity. When every interaction feels like a natural continuation of the previous one, the mind is freed from unnecessary cognitive load and can focus on evaluating choices rationally rather than struggling to understand the interface itself.

Visual hierarchy plays a significant role in supporting rational thought. By guiding attention naturally, without abrupt contrasts or distractions, interfaces can direct users to the information that matters most. Hierarchies that emphasize clarity over flamboyance prevent sensory overload, which in turn prevents rushed or emotionally-driven choices. The careful use of spacing, alignment, and grouping of elements ensures that important data is prominent and accessible while peripheral information remains non-intrusive. Such subtlety promotes thoughtful examination of options, giving users the time and mental space to weigh consequences and consider strategies rather than reacting on instinct.

The interplay of motion and feedback also contributes to calmness. Animations that are smooth and meaningful provide reassurance without startling the user. Abrupt transitions, flashing elements, or excessive visual noise can trigger stress responses that interfere with rational thinking. Instead, interfaces that employ gentle cues for success, warning, or error support comprehension while maintaining a relaxed atmosphere. Haptic feedback, sound cues, and visual signals can reinforce actions subtly, ensuring that users remain aware of outcomes without becoming emotionally agitated. These design choices collectively nurture an environment conducive to deliberate thought.

Beyond visual and interactive elements, textual clarity enhances rational engagement. Labels, instructions, and messages that are concise, consistent, and free of ambiguity reduce the mental effort needed to interpret meaning. Overly complex language or unclear terminology forces users to make assumptions, increasing the likelihood of mistakes or impulsive decisions. By prioritizing simplicity and directness, interfaces enable users to process information efficiently, supporting calculated judgment and intentional choices. When users understand exactly what to do, and why, they feel more competent and are better equipped to think through each step methodically.

Another critical dimension is the pacing of interaction. Systems that allow users to operate at a comfortable speed, without artificial pressure or time-based stress, enhance cognitive performance. Rush prompts, countdowns, or sudden requirement shifts can trigger reactive behaviors that undermine rational assessment. In contrast, interfaces that respect user timing and provide subtle guidance create space for reflection. The ability to pause, review, and adjust decisions without fear of immediate penalty encourages measured approaches and reduces the influence of emotional bias. Users who feel in control of the pace are more likely to engage in thoughtful evaluation rather than hasty execution.

Emotionally, relaxed interfaces foster confidence and trust. When users perceive that the system is predictable, non-aggressive, and considerate of their experience, they are less likely to experience anxiety or frustration. Confidence in one’s ability to navigate and understand a platform supports higher-level thinking and reduces impulsivity. Trust is reinforced when outcomes are consistent, feedback is clear, and the environment signals stability. Users who feel secure are more willing to explore options, experiment strategically, and make decisions grounded in logic rather than reaction. The emotional state induced by interface design is thus inextricably linked to cognitive performance.

Accessibility and personalization further enhance rational engagement. Interfaces that adapt to individual user needs, accommodating preferences for layout, contrast, or interaction style, reduce friction and cognitive strain. Customizable settings allow users to minimize stressors unique to their own perception or cognitive profile, supporting focused and intentional decision-making. Moreover, accessibility features such as clear labeling, adjustable text size, and alternative feedback modes ensure that no user is disadvantaged by sensory overload or complex design. When everyone can comfortably engage with an interface, the overall quality of reasoning improves across diverse user populations.

Even the subtle arrangement of information affects rationality. Grouping related data, highlighting critical elements, and providing clear affordances for action prevent confusion and misinterpretation. Users who can quickly identify patterns, compare options, and trace cause-and-effect relationships are better positioned to act logically. Interfaces that emphasize clarity and minimize clutter reinforce a mental model where consequences and probabilities are transparent, reducing errors born from oversight or misperception. Every design choice that reduces ambiguity serves to enhance deliberate thinking.

Ultimately, a relaxed interface nurtures an environment where rational thought is not just possible but encouraged. By combining visual calmness, consistent feedback, textual clarity, appropriate pacing, and emotional stability, these designs reduce the mental noise that typically hampers decision-making. Users operate with greater confidence, process information more effectively, and engage in behaviors that reflect thoughtful consideration. Far from being a superficial luxury, calm interface design is a practical strategy for promoting intelligent interaction, supporting choices that are deliberate, measured, and rational across any digital context. In such spaces, users are empowered to act not from impulse but from reason, making the interface itself an ally in clear, controlled, and rational engagement.
